87.05 percent of the population in 89130 drive to work alone. 1.36 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 60.99 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 3.77 percent of the residents in 89130 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.58 members with about 2.26 cars available per household.
An estimate of 92.87 percent of the residents in 89130 has some form of health insurance. 36.64 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 69.88 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 89130 would have to travel an average of 2.91 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Mountainview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 89130, Las Vegas, Nevada.

As of , an estimate of 34,439 residents live in 89130 with a median age of 41.7 years. 21.53 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 19.81 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 37.35 percent of the residents in 89130 is currently married, and 21.74 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 89130 is $7,341.42.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 89130 is approximately $1,353. The median household spends about 18.43 percent of their income on housing.

Alzheimer's disease is a progressive brain disorder that affects memory, thinking skills, and behavior. It is the most common cause of dementia, a general term for memory loss and other cognitive abilities severe enough to interfere with daily life. As the disease advances, individuals may require specialized medical care to address their evolving needs.

In terms of transportation options, the 89130 area is well-connected with various public transit services and ride-sharing companies. The Regional Transportation Commission of Southern Nevada (RTC) operates bus routes throughout the city, providing convenient access to healthcare facilities for individuals without personal vehicles. Additionally, popular ride-sharing services such as Uber and Lyft are readily available in Las Vegas, offering another flexible transportation option for residents.
